In general, Khat is best when fresh off the bush. The bushes will take quite a few years before they are useful, it helps to keep nipping out the new shoots to encourage bushiness, which also stresses them into production of the good stuff.

If dried, do not use heat. Papers suggest drying for up to 72 hours at no more than 20°C will not significantly change the ratio of alks, but there's a lot of contradictory opinions.

What I mean is cut or pinch off the tips of branches to force new shoots out of the lower nodes. This will increase the bushiness. You could make tea from fresh leaves, but the heat will make the process of cathinone turning to cathine happen faster. And yes, young plants won't produce much - in terms of weight or desirable alkaloids.
